Take 5 Car Wash generally offers multiple paths for canceling a membership, though the specific options may vary by location or membership type. The primary cancellation method for most members is through their online account portal. When logged into your account on the Take 5 website, look for sections labeled "Account Settings," "Membership Management," "Manage Subscription," or similar terms. Many companies include a "Cancel Membership" button or link in these sections. Clicking this option typically begins an automated cancellation process that may ask you to confirm your request and provide a reason for cancellation.

Phone contact is another standard cancellation method. Take 5 Car Wash provides customer service phone numbers on their website. When calling, have your membership number, account email, and last four digits of your payment method available. Customer service representatives can process cancellations directly over the phone and often provide confirmation numbers or reference numbers documenting when your cancellation was requested. Speaking with a representative allows you to ask questions about your final charges, outstanding balances, or any specific terms of your membership cancellation.
In-person cancellation at a physical Take 5 location is a third option for some members. You can visit any Take 5 Car Wash location and speak with staff at the front counter or office. Bring identification and information about your membership account. In-person cancellation provides immediate confirmation and allows staff to process the request on the spot. However, depending on location staffing and systems, some locations may direct you to cancel online or by phone instead.
Members who purchased their membership through a third-party platform face different cancellation procedures. If you bought membership through Groupon, Living Social, or another deal site, you may need to cancel through that platform rather than directly with Take 5. Log into your account on the deal site, find your Take 5 purchase, and look for cancellation or refund options within that platform. These third-party sites often have their own cancellation timelines and policies, which may differ from Take 5's standard procedures.
Email cancellation represents a less common but sometimes available option. You can compose a cancellation request email to Take 5's customer service address, which you can find on their website. Include your full name, membership number, account email address, and clear statement that you want to cancel your membership. Request written confirmation of your cancellation. While email cancellation is slower than phone or online options, it creates a written record of your request.

The timing of your cancellation request significantly affects when your membership officially ends and when charges stop appearing on your billing statement. Most memberships do not cancel immediately upon request. Instead, cancellation typically takes effect at the end of your current billing cycle. For example, if you cancel on the 15th of the month but your membership renewal date is the 25th, your membership will remain active until the 25th, and you will be charged one final time on that date.

This is an important detail because many people assume cancellation happens the moment they request it. Understanding your billing cycle helps you plan your cancellation timing. If you want to avoid one more charge, canceling a few days before your renewal date may not work—the charge may already be processed. However, canceling immediately after a charge is made gives you the maximum time until the next renewal date.
Take 5 memberships typically renew on a monthly basis, though some premium or bundled plans may have different billing cycles. Check your account to identify your specific renewal date. Your account information or billing statement should clearly show when your next charge is scheduled. Some membership terms are tied to the calendar date you enrolled (for example, the 10th of each month), while others might be tied to the day of the week you originally signed up.
